In terms of pharmacological mechanism, Enalapril is a prodrug that is hydrolyzed into active enalaprilat after entering the human body. It specifically inhibits angiotensin-converting enzyme and blocks the conversion of angiotensin I to angiotensin II. As a powerful vasoconstrictor, angiotensin II causes vascular contraction, elevated blood pressure, water-sodium retention and myocardial fibrosis. By cutting off this pathological pathway, Enalapril effectively dilates peripheral blood vessels, reduces vascular resistance and stabilizes blood pressure. Meanwhile, it inhibits aldosterone secretion, reduces water and sodium retention, relieves cardiac load, reverses ventricular hypertrophy and vascular remodeling, and realizes long-term protection of the heart, kidneys and blood vessels, significantly reducing the risk of cardiovascular events.
Clinically, Enalapril has wide indications and stable curative effects, serving as a first-line API for hypertension and heart failure treatment. For primary and secondary hypertension, its 24-hour long-acting effect ensures stable blood pressure control and avoids sharp day-night blood pressure fluctuations, suitable for long-term maintenance treatment of mild, moderate and severe hypertension. For patients with chronic congestive heart failure and left ventricular dysfunction, Enalapril improves myocardial blood supply, reduces cardiac preload and afterload, enhances exercise tolerance and delays disease progression, effectively lowering hospitalization and mortality rates. In addition, it can be flexibly combined with diuretics and calcium channel blockers to achieve synergistic effects, making it an indispensable component of compound antihypertensive preparations.
In terms of safety and industrial application, Enalapril presents excellent overall tolerance. Compared with short-acting ACEIs, it has a significantly lower incidence of dry cough and fewer side effects such as tachycardia and orthostatic hypotension, enabling safe long-term medication for elderly and chronic disease patients. It has no obvious liver and kidney toxicity under conventional doses with mild metabolism.
